Understanding the Different Types of Cots
Before diving into sales and discount rates, it assists to narrow down exactly which kind of cot is needed. The term "cot" covers a number of distinct item classifications, each serving an entirely various purpose.
1. Baby Cots and Cribs
Developed for babies and toddlers, baby cots prioritize security, resilience, and comfort. Many contemporary cots are "convertible," implying they transform from a newborn crib into a toddler bed and often even a daybed or full-size bed frame.
- Secret Feature: Adjustable mattress heights.
- Safety Standard: Must meet stringent government guidelines (e.g., JPMA certification in the US).
2. Camping Cots
Portable sleeping platforms used for outdoor leisure, emergency readiness, or extra indoor guest sleeping. They elevate the sleeper off the cold, hard ground and often feature folding aluminum or steel frames with long lasting canvas or polyester fabric.
- Secret Feature: Portability, weight capability, and ease of assembly.
- Varieties: Standard military-style, retractable, and ultralight backpacking cots.
3. Travel Cots and Pack-and-Plays
Compact, lightweight enclosures created for babies and toddlers on the go. They function as safe play spaces and portable beds during vacations or sees to grandparents' houses.

When an appealing discount rate appears, it is easy to make an impulse purchase. Nevertheless, buyers need to constantly evaluate numerous critical requirements before inspecting out.
For Baby and Nursery Cots:
- Safety Certifications: Never jeopardize on safety. Ensure the cot fulfills existing security requirements, functions non-toxic surfaces, and has slat spacings no wider than 2 3/8 inches.
- Convertibility: Buying a 3-in-1 or 4-in-1 convertible cot for sale on sale supplies long-lasting value, as it grows with the kid through their early years.
- Bed mattress Fit: Check whether the price consists of a bed mattress. Numerous discounted cots require buying the mattress individually, which can add unforeseen expenses.
For Camping and Travel Cots:
- Weight and Portability: If treking or backpacking, an ultralight aluminum Cot Sale is ideal. For cars and truck outdoor camping or visitor usage, a tougher, padded steel cot supplies remarkable comfort.
- Weight Capacity: Always examine the optimum weight limitation to guarantee toughness and safety for various users.
- Setup Mechanism: Some cots need substantial muscle power to lock completion bars into place, while others include quick-folding accordion frames.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Are baby cots on sale safe to purchase?
Yes, provided they satisfy present security policies. Always buy from respectable brand names and retailers. Avoid purchasing utilized drop-side baby cribs, as they have been prohibited due to security risks. If buying a new discounted cot from a major merchant, it will meet all contemporary safety standards.
2. Do camping cots come with mattresses?
The majority of standard camping cots consist of a metal frame and tensioned material only. While some luxury or padded models have integrated cushioning, users usually need to add a sleeping pad, blow-up mattress, or foam topper for ideal convenience.
3. Can I return a cot if I purchased it on last sale?
Products marked as "Final Sale" or "Clearance" typically can not be returned or exchanged. It is important to carefully measure the readily available area and read item reviews before buying final-sale items.
4. What is the basic size of a baby cot mattress?
In the United States and Canada, basic full-size crib bed mattress should be at least 27 1/4 inches by 51 5/8 inches, with a density not surpassing 6 inches, guaranteeing a tight and safe fit inside standard cots.
